JTAG Help! I think I killed my JTAG's KV/NAND?

hot_wired13

Full Member
Nov 16, 2004
45
6
Singapore
Then you could change the key in Jtag tool and the drive type.
I don't have the original drive key since xellous reads it as all zeroes. What I do have is a sam_cfw.bin file from the seller.

I'm confused now - does that mean I need to re-create a KV using the JTAG tool or what? And what do u mean by change the key inside? From what to what?
 

Fisticuffs

VIP Member
Mar 14, 2011
1,316
68
Arizona, US
Ask Him again for the original nand.bin, Not the updflash.bin, You'll need it for jtag tool to edit the kv_info, Not sure if you can get the kvinfo from the updflash.bin,

To edit the dvd info, First open the nand, Then where it says cpu key, Put yours there, Then click get info, Then you'll beable to edit the dvd key and what type of drive it is you got from jf from your samcfw.bin, Then click apply and extract the kvinfo and save it

Also here's some reading material
http://www.team-xecuter.com/forums/showthread.php?t=54802
http://www.team-xecuter.com/forums/showthread.php?t=54531
 
Last edited:

hot_wired13

Full Member
Nov 16, 2004
45
6
Singapore
Awesome, thanks for the reading material. Really appreciated! Glad to learn a more complete picture of things rather than just "do this" and "do that".

I'm curious though - previously, I accidentally flashed my stock nand.bin onto the NAND. Why doesn't it even boot up like an "original" xbox360? Is it due to the JTAG wiring in place?

And also, from the photos, I can't see any JTAG wiring (or maybe I'm missing something?)
 

Martin C

VIP Member
Jan 10, 2004
35,981
0
Scotland, UK
www.team-xecuter.com
looking at the picture the only thing I can assume is that the wiring is underneath the motherboard instead of on top....I use to wire that way when I first started
When I was using Diodes, that's how I did all of mine ;)
 

TilVl

VIP Member
May 11, 2011
1,383
0
Reporting bad KV is due to CPU key. Not showing DVD key on Xell or Xellous is because kv was never injected into xell/xellous.

Use Jtag Tool to build a Freeboot image.

Still need nand-x or wire up an LPT cable.

You can use jtag tool to build your freeboot image.

I built an image with just KV and config.

If you copied the CPU key from Xell could be possible the CPU key and KV are not correct. From a donor nand.
 
Last edited:

hot_wired13

Full Member
Nov 16, 2004
45
6
Singapore
Ask Him again for the original nand.bin, Not the updflash.bin, You'll need it for jtag tool to edit the kv_info, Not sure if you can get the kvinfo from the updflash.bin,

To edit the dvd info, First open the nand, Then where it says cpu key, Put yours there, Then click get info, Then you'll beable to edit the dvd key and what type of drive it is you got from jf from your samcfw.bin, Then click apply and extract the kvinfo and save it

Also here's some reading material
http://www.team-xecuter.com/forums/showthread.php?t=54802
http://www.team-xecuter.com/forums/showthread.php?t=54531
I've tried loading the 2 copies of nand.bin, and even updflash.bin into JTAG Tool like your screenshot - I get an error saying "Wrong CPU KEY - cannot decrypt KV".

I think what TilVl says might be right about bad KV being wrong CPU key... but I obtained this CPU key through XeLLous - so its very possible it might be donor?

What do I do now? Do i continue following TilVl's steps? Or?
 

hot_wired13

Full Member
Nov 16, 2004
45
6
Singapore
Hi guys, here are my assumptions from what I've read so far. Please correct my assumptions if they are wrong.

1. XeLLous ALWAYS displays the right key, since it pulls it from the motherboard.

2. In this case, if I have the RIGHT key, but I can't decrypt the KV... well, it probably means that the only solution is to use a donor KV over? Or can I just "generate" one? Or am I wrong?
 

Martin C

VIP Member
Jan 10, 2004
35,981
0
Scotland, UK
www.team-xecuter.com
make a note of the CPU key from your screen (yes, Xellous will always show the correct one). Then use 360 Flash Dump Tool 0.97 and enter the key in settings. Then try opening the NAND dumps you have. If it can't decrypt the DVD information on the right of the app, they were built using the wrong key. Contact the guy who did it and ask for your correct dump.
 

TilVl

VIP Member
May 11, 2011
1,383
0
If you can't get the orig dump, or the KV that uses your CPU key.

Just get a donor.

Make sure you have the CPU key for your donor nand.
 

hot_wired13

Full Member
Nov 16, 2004
45
6
Singapore
Hey guys,

Okay, I found a donor Falcon bin and managed to swap the KV over to the old updflash.bin which my seller previously gave me.
(If i just flashed updflash.bin which seller gave me, I can access the dash, etc, but DVD drives dont work and I get KV_error)

I flashed updflash.bin into the console and... when I turn it on, the light is green but there is no output (tried HDMI and AV cables, both no output). I also cannot get the controllers to sync.

However, if I boot the console by using the DVD Drive button, I am able to go into Xellous and everything looks good (no more errors, DVD and CPU key shows!)

My question is... what do I need to do to get the dashboard and all working?

Edit: I tried using the original nand.bin the seller gave and swapping keyvaults and then patching with freeboot via jtag tool - worse.. Christmas Lights! Is there an easier way to do this?

Edit 2: Argh, this is so irritating. I've tried so many ways (i.e, patching different images - nand vs freeboot, etc) and tried patching key from donor nand, etc. but still no luck. Perhaps someone kind could help me make an image to flash? The drive is a Samsung ms25 (456576CF131C5E340E947E4F1006955E) and the CPU Key is: 79351CC85672A6D25C2BD1D26E59B1F0 - a banned keyvault or anything would be fine too... anything to save me from this headache! :(
 
Last edited:

hot_wired13

Full Member
Nov 16, 2004
45
6
Singapore
Wrong SMC. Make sure the SMC is configured for your wiring.
I'm not sure what wiring is this, but I know for sure there's no wires above the board.

Inside JTAG Tool, I went to Drivers/Options and chose "Aud_Clamp & DVD_Tray" and tried to make freeboot with my original nand.bin + patched KV.

When flashed, I got an e79 though.

Where should I follow/what tools should I grab to try other SMC's? And how should I do it?
 

hot_wired13

Full Member
Nov 16, 2004
45
6
Singapore
You said you had a working Falcon nand correct? Send me what you have.

[email protected] ill make you an image.
Thanks for helping, TilVl! :) Much appreciated!

DVD Key: http://dl.dropbox.com/u/77055/falcon/dvd_key.txt
Fuses/CPU Key: http://dl.dropbox.com/u/77055/falcon/fuses.txt
Seller-provided NAND.bin: http://dl.dropbox.com/u/77055/falcon/nand.bin
Seller-provided Drive Firmware: http://dl.dropbox.com/u/77055/falcon/Sam_CFW.bin
Seller-provided updflash.bin (working if I flash it to NAND, but seems like corrupted KV): http://dl.dropbox.com/u/77055/falcon/updflash.bin

Here are also some pics of the wiring (seller did it, I'm not sure which wiring is it):





 

TilVl

VIP Member
May 11, 2011
1,383
0
Looks like Orginal Wiring. Try this one. Let me know if it works or not.

http://www.megaupload.com/?d=398XH132

Should change the wiring. Take off the switching Diodes and the transistor method with AUD_CLAMP / TRAY_OPEN.

Helps pull the logic to 0. Get a clean boot every time.
 
Last edited: